美团推出骑手不闯红灯奖励,最高可获万元
Xin Lang Ke Ji· 2025-12-03 03:47
Core Insights - Meituan has reported a 15% year-on-year decrease in traffic accidents involving its delivery riders as part of its traffic safety governance efforts [1] - The company is launching a new safety incentive program starting December 2, which will reward riders for not running red lights, with an estimated one million riders expected to benefit [1] - The shift in strategy from "negative control" to "positive incentives" includes the cancellation of penalties for late deliveries and the establishment of a safety incentive pool totaling 100 million yuan [1] Group 1 - Meituan's traffic safety governance has led to a 15% reduction in traffic accidents among riders [1] - The new incentive program will reward riders with cash for not running red lights, covering nearly 200 cities [1] - Over 440,000 riders have benefited from the safety governance initiatives in the past year [1] Group 2 - The "No Red Light Award" and the "Safety Star" prize are part of the new incentive structure, with cash rewards ranging from 8,888 to 10,000 yuan for top performers [1] - The initiative aims to encourage compliance with traffic regulations among riders [1] - The program reflects a broader trend in the industry towards incentivizing safe driving behaviors [1]
受“外卖大战”拖累 美团第三季度净亏损160亿元
Xi Niu Cai Jing· 2025-12-03 03:28
Core Insights - Meituan reported a significant net loss in Q3 2025, marking the first operational loss in its core business in three years, with adjusted net loss reaching 16.01 billion RMB compared to a profit of 12.83 billion RMB in the same period last year [2][5][7] Financial Performance - Total revenue for Q3 2025 was 95.49 billion RMB, a year-on-year growth of only 2.0% [2][4] - The net profit margin fell to -16.75%, with a substantial decline from the previous year's profit [2] - The core local commerce segment generated revenue of 67.45 billion RMB, down 2.8% year-on-year, resulting in an operational loss of 14.07 billion RMB [4][5] Segment Analysis - Meituan's delivery service revenue decreased by 17.1% to 23.02 billion RMB, while commission revenue grew by only 1.1% to 26.38 billion RMB [5] - Online marketing services revenue increased by 5.7% to 14.19 billion RMB, and other services saw a significant growth of 84.9% to 3.86 billion RMB [5] Cost Structure - Sales costs surged by 23.7% to 70.31 billion RMB, accounting for 73.6% of total revenue, an increase of 12.9 percentage points year-on-year [5][6] - Sales and marketing expenses rose by 91% to 34.27 billion RMB, representing 35.9% of total revenue, up from 19.2% [5][6] Market Position - Despite the losses, Meituan maintained a leading market share in high-value orders, capturing over two-thirds of the market for orders above 15 RMB and over 70% for orders above 30 RMB [7] - Meituan's market share in instant transactions was 47.1%, with a reported loss of 20% market share compared to previous periods [7] User Metrics - The number of monthly transaction users for Meituan's food delivery service reached a historical high, with total transaction users exceeding 800 million in the past 12 months [7] New Business Developments - The new business segment reported a revenue increase of 15.9% to 28.04 billion RMB, although operating losses increased by 24.5% to 1.3 billion RMB [8] - Meituan's Keeta business is expanding globally, with operations in Hong Kong and Saudi Arabia showing steady growth and improved operational efficiency [8] Cash Reserves - As of September 30, 2025, Meituan held cash and cash equivalents of 99.2 billion RMB, along with short-term investments totaling 42.1 billion RMB, amounting to a total cash reserve of 141.3 billion RMB [8]
全国总工会指导美团与骑手签保障协议,美团养老保险年内要覆盖全国
Sou Hu Cai Jing· 2025-09-19 05:25
Core Points - The 2025 Meituan Delivery Rider Rights Protection Negotiation Conference was held in Beijing, focusing on labor remuneration, rest and leave, labor protection, care guarantees, and career development for riders, benefiting over ten million riders nationwide [1][5] - Meituan has implemented a "no penalty for overtime" mechanism in over 30 cities, which will be fully rolled out by the end of this year, shifting management from punitive measures to positive incentives [1][3] - Meituan will subsidize 50% of the pension insurance costs for riders, covering one million riders this year, with no restrictions on qualification, location, or type of delivery [3][5] - The company has established a comprehensive insurance system for riders, including work injury insurance, which has already covered 17 provinces and cities, with over 1.5 billion yuan paid in insurance fees [3][5] - Meituan is enhancing safety governance measures, including safety reminders and training, to ensure riders' safety during deliveries, while also addressing concerns about the differences in platform regulations [4][5] - A special agreement was signed at the conference, detailing various protections for riders, including income guarantees during adverse weather, elimination of overtime deductions, and support for riders' families [5][6] - Meituan is committed to improving rider work experiences and living conditions, maintaining transparency, and accepting public supervision to build a fairer labor ecosystem [6]
“中国供应链是奇迹”!黄仁勋穿唐装、首次中文演讲,点赞11家中国企业!
证券时报· 2025-07-16 09:10
Core Viewpoint - Huang Renxun's visit to China highlights the importance of the Chinese market for Nvidia, especially following the approval to sell the H20 chip, which has contributed to the company's stock price reaching a historic high of over $4.1 trillion in market capitalization [1][7]. Group 1: Nvidia's Development and AI Contributions - Huang Renxun summarized Nvidia's evolution from a startup in 1993 to a leader in AI technology, emphasizing milestones such as the introduction of the first programmable GPU in 1999 and the launch of the DGX-1 AI supercomputer in 2016 [3][4]. - AI is transforming various industries, with significant contributions from Chinese companies like Tencent, Alibaba, and ByteDance, which are leveraging Nvidia's platform for innovation [4]. - Over 1.5 million developers in China are innovating on Nvidia's platform, with Chinese open-source models driving global AI development [4]. Group 2: Future of AI and Supply Chain - Huang Renxun anticipates that the next wave of AI will focus on understanding the physical world, predicting the emergence of task-executing robotic systems within the next decade [4]. - He praised China's supply chain as a miracle, highlighting the innovative spirit and commitment to collaboration for a prosperous future [4]. Group 3: Nvidia's Market Position and Stock Performance - Nvidia's stock reached a new high, with a market capitalization of $4.165 trillion, significantly outpacing other tech giants like Apple and Microsoft [7]. - The approval to sell the H20 chip to China is seen as a crucial development, especially after a previous ban that impacted Nvidia's revenue significantly [7][8].
